The Beluga Whale tank is particularly exciting; it has a surface-level area as well as an underwater viewing room.
Beluga Whale came from Alaska and Antarctica where the waters are very cold.
They swim among icebergs where water temperature may be as low as 32*F.
The Beluga has a well adaption to both cold ocean habitat and a warmer fresh water habitat.
The Beluga or white whale grows to 15 feet long.
They eat octopus, crabs, squid, and some fish like cod.
The aquarium has to cool their water to a constant 54* to keep them comfortable.
They usually have a routine that they follow much like at Sea World San Diego.
Today it was the first 80* day of the season.
They let them just swim and see what the whale wanted to do in the warm weather. They didn’t want to play.
Beluga do not exhibit as many aerial behaviors like jumping etc. that the killer whale and dolphins exhibit.
